The average monthly number of abortions has risen from 79,600 in 2022 to 98,800 in 2025--a 24 percent increase in just three years. And telehealth abortion increased 61 percent over the last year. @msmagazine.com @plancpills.bsky.social

Global telehealth abortion provider Women Help Women is now producing its own combipack of one mife and eight miso tablets, and says they will start serving the US if the FDA restricts access to telehealth abortion. @msmagazine.com @plancpills.bsky.social
